Why Inter Kashi's ISL Debut Signings Matter
The Indian Super League (ISL) 2025-26 season is fast approaching, and newly promoted Inter Kashi is making waves with its strategic squad building. The I-League champions have secured four foreign additions to prepare for their debut in the top-tier league.
Building a Balanced Squad for ISL
Instead of opting for a complete overhaul, Inter Kashi has chosen to blend familiarity with experience. This approach is expected to help the team navigate the challenges of the ISL while maintaining a sense of continuity.
Goalkeeping: Llus Tarrs
Standing at 1.89 meters, Llus Tarrs brings a commanding presence in goal. Known for his reflex saves and ability to dominate the penalty area, Tarrs offers a modern profile suited to possession-based systems.
Midfield: Sergio Llamas
With genuine top-flight pedigree, Sergio Llamas brings calmness on the ball and leadership to Inter Kashi's midfield. His ability to dictate tempo and operate as a deep-lying playmaker or an attacking number 8 will be invaluable for the team.
Winger: Alfred Planas
Alfred Planas, a dynamic winger, brings pace, directness, and a willingness to take defenders on. His ability to unlock stubborn defences will be a significant asset for Inter Kashi in the ISL.
Defense: David Humanes
David Humanes, a familiar face returning to Inter Kashi, offers physicality and aerial strength. His experience in multiple leagues, including Bulgaria, Romania, Armenia, and Spain, will be beneficial for the team in the ISL.
